A joint resolution designating October 1990 as "National Domestic Violence Awareness Month".

Introduced: May 24, 1990 See on congress.gov

Oct 10, 1990
Referred to the House Committee on Post Office and Civil Service.
Oct 10, 1990
Received in the House.
Oct 5, 1990
Passed Senate without amendment and with a preamble by Voice Vote.
Oct 5, 1990
Passed/agreed to in Senate: Passed Senate without amendment and with a preamble by Voice Vote.
Oct 5, 1990
Senate Committee on Judiciary discharged by Unanimous Consent.
May 24, 1990
Read twice and referred to the Committee on Judiciary.
May 24, 1990
Introduced in Senate
